Background: |
ATPase beta subunit, which is a subunit of ATP synthase and part of the CF1 portion which catalyzes the conversion of ADP to ATP using the proton motive force. This complex is located in the thylakoid membrane of the chloroplast. |

Specificity And Cross Reactions
PHY0011A | Arabidopsis thaliana, Vitis vinifera, Brassica napus, Zea mays, Medicago truncatula, Brassica rapa, Triticum aestivum, Glycine max, Oryza sativa, Solanum tuberosum, Solanum lycopersicum, Hordeum vulgare, Setaria viridis, Populus trichocarpa, Sorghum bicolor, Nicotiana tabacum, Gossypium raimondii, Spinacia oleracea, Panicum virgatum, Cucumis sativus, Leymus chinensis, Physcomitrella patens. The sequence of the synthetic peptide used for immunization is also 93% homologues with the sequence in mitochondrial ATP synthase beta subunit At5g08670, At5g08680, At5g08690. |
